    What does the kWh unit of a solar energy system refer to

    The terms kW (kilowatt) and kWh (kilowatt-hour) are often used in the context of energy consumption and solar power systems, but they refer to different concepts: A kW rating tells you how powerful the system is at any given moment;kWh tells you how much energy it produces over a day, month, or year.


    FAQs about What does the kWh unit of a solar energy system refer to

    What is a kWh number on a solar system?

    The kWh number the solar company puts on your home solar system is a little different than the kW rating of the solar system. A kWh measures how much energy is being used or produced during a period of time. The 6 kW home solar system in NJ for example, may produce 7,200 kWh of solar power per year.

    What is a kilowatt-hour solar system?

    A kilowatt (kW) measures the power output at any given moment, similar to how a car's horsepower is measured. Kilowatt-hour (kWh) quantifies energy consumption over time, akin to how much fuel a car uses over a journey. Choosing the right solar setup involves balancing kW and kWh based on your household's energy needs.

    What is the relationship between kW and kWh in a solar system?

    Decker explained the relationship between kW and kWh in a solar system this way: If you have a 10-kW solar panel system, it will produce approximately 10 kWh of energy if it runs for one hour in optimal conditions.

    What does bms mean for solar energy storage cabinet lithium battery in botswana

    Battery Management Systems (BMS) are vital components for solar storage, streamlining the charge and discharge of the solar battery bank while monitoring important parameters like voltage, temperature, and state of charge. This guarantees your solar cells resist damage, overcharging, overheating. Every solar battery has a hidden hero inside it — the BMS, or Battery Management System. You won't see it on the outside, and you won't interact with it directly, but it quietly protects and optimises your battery every second of the day. Think of the BMS as the brain of your solar battery. It protects the battery from damage, optimizes performance, and extends its lifespan.     What products does the energy storage liquid-cooled battery cabinet include

    Core highlights: The liquid-cooled battery container is integrated with battery clusters, converging power distribution cabinets, liquid-cooled units, automatic fire-fighting systems, lighting systems, pressure relief and exhaust systems, etc.


    FAQs about What products does the energy storage liquid-cooled battery cabinet include

    What is included in a battery management system?

    In addition to battery cells, there are switch-disconnectors, contactors, sensors, sampling lines, battery management systems, as well as control units being integrated into the same battery rack. BESS employs a sophisticated, multilevel battery management system (BMS) for system monitoring and control. Each battery management system including:

    How does a battery cooling pump work?

    Working principle of Liquid Cooling Battery Cooling: Cooling liquid powered by the pump will circulate inside battery modules and take the heat from batteries. When the liquid gets out of the battery modules, it became hot liquid with the heat from batteries. The hot liquid will circle back to a heat exchanging tank.

    How many temperature detectors does a battery module have?

    Each battery module has 8 temperature detectors. There are 2 racks that fit in a single battery cabinet, 9 slots in each battery rack to accommodate 8 battery modules and total 1 BSPU (Battery Switch & Protective Unit). Racks are connected in parallel and paired with a system BMS to meet the power and energy requirements of the application at hand.

    What is a battery module made of?

    The external casing is made of metal covered by insulating materials. For example, the top cover is made of PP, the bottom base is made of aluminum. The copper bars and screws are connected internally to prevent short circuit to ensure the electrical safety of the battery module. Each battery module has 8 temperature detectors.

    What is a battery rack?

    Each battery rack contains a rack-level BMS. The positive (+) and negative (-) terminals of the battery modules are clearly marked and are designed for the convenience of connection, visual check, examine, and repair. The external casing is made of metal covered by insulating materials.

    How many battery cells are in a battery rack?

    All wire connections are placed on the front side of the rack to allow easy installation and maintenance. Since each battery rack hosts 8 battery modules and each battery module has 52 battery cells, each battery Rack has a total of 416 battery cells connected in series.

    What is a battery cabinet?

    A battery cabinet houses and protects the batteries that supply stored energy to a UPS system. It ensures that backup power is readily available whenever primary power is interrupted. Battery cabinets can be installed indoors or outdoors and are designed to provide secure, organized, and scalable energy storage for continuous power delivery.

    What is a lithium battery cabinet?

    A lithium battery cabinet offers several advantages over traditional lead-acid designs, including higher energy density, longer lifespan, faster recharge times, and reduced maintenance requirements. Lithium UPS batteries can deliver more runtime in a smaller footprint, making them ideal for facilities where space and efficiency are priorities.
